POSITION OVERVIEW
This position is responsible for conducting due diligence research for those that would be considered higher risk customers. The position also requires documentation review for new customer accounts, evaluates high-risk accounts for risk rating, and analyzes trends, patterns, and then performs a written analysis of the overall relationship. Additional responsibilities include review and disposition of OFAC alerts, inquiries, and potential OFAC suspects. This person works under the supervision of the BSA Officer and KYC/EDD Team Lead.
